What to Look for in a Pediatric Surgeon

Choosing a pediatric surgeon is a critical decision that requires careful evaluation of several key factors. First and foremost, parents should prioritize the surgeon’s qualifications and experience. Board certification in pediatric surgery is essential, as it indicates that the surgeon has undergone rigorous training and has met specific standards of excellence in the field.

Additionally, parents should inquire about the surgeon’s experience with the particular procedure their child requires. A surgeon who specializes in a specific type of surgery will likely have more expertise and better outcomes than one who performs a broader range of procedures infrequently. Another important consideration is the surgeon’s approach to patient care and communication.

Parents should feel comfortable discussing their child’s condition and treatment options openly. A good pediatric surgeon will take the time to explain the procedure in detail, addressing any concerns or questions that parents may have. They should also demonstrate empathy and understanding toward both the child and their family, recognizing that surgery can be a daunting experience for everyone involved.

Furthermore, it is beneficial to consider the surgical facility where the procedure will take place. A children’s hospital or a facility with specialized pediatric surgical units often provides an environment tailored to the unique needs of young patients, which can enhance both safety and comfort during the surgical process.

The Importance of Regular Check-ups for Children

Regular check-ups are an essential component of maintaining a child’s health and well-being. These routine visits allow pediatricians to monitor growth and development, ensuring that children meet important milestones as they age. During these appointments, healthcare providers can conduct necessary screenings for vision and hearing issues, as well as assess overall physical health through vaccinations and preventive care measures.

Early detection of potential health concerns can lead to timely interventions, which are crucial for addressing issues before they escalate into more significant problems. Moreover, regular check-ups provide an invaluable opportunity for parents to engage with healthcare professionals about their child’s health concerns or behavioral issues. These visits foster open communication between families and pediatricians, allowing parents to voice any worries they may have regarding their child’s development or emotional well-being.

Pediatricians can offer guidance on nutrition, physical activity, and mental health resources during these appointments, equipping families with tools to promote healthy lifestyles. Ultimately, prioritizing regular check-ups not only supports children’s physical health but also nurtures their emotional and psychological development.

How to Prepare Your Child for Surgery

Preparing a child for surgery can be a daunting task for parents, but with thoughtful planning and open communication, it can be made less intimidating for both parties involved. One of the first steps is to explain the procedure in age-appropriate terms, ensuring that your child understands what will happen without overwhelming them with unnecessary details. Using simple language and visual aids can help demystify the surgical process, making it feel less frightening.

It is also essential to address any fears or anxieties your child may have by encouraging them to express their feelings openly. In addition to emotional preparation, practical steps should be taken to ensure that your child is ready for surgery day. This includes discussing pre-operative instructions with your healthcare provider, such as dietary restrictions or medication adjustments leading up to the procedure.

Parents should also prepare their child for what to expect post-surgery, including potential discomfort or limitations on activities during recovery. Creating a supportive environment at home post-surgery can aid in your child’s healing process; having favorite toys or books readily available can provide comfort during recovery. By taking these steps, parents can help alleviate anxiety and foster a sense of security for their child as they approach surgery.

FAQs

What are pediatricians and pediatric surgeons?

Pediatricians are doctors who specialize in the medical care of infants, children, and adolescents. They provide preventive care, diagnose and treat illnesses, and monitor growth and development. Pediatric surgeons are specialized surgeons who perform surgeries on infants, children, and adolescents for a wide range of medical conditions.

What services do pediatricians and pediatric surgeons provide?

Pediatricians provide a range of services including well-child visits, immunizations, treatment of common illnesses, and management of chronic conditions. Pediatric surgeons perform surgeries for conditions such as congenital anomalies, trauma, tumors, and other surgical needs specific to children.

What are some common pediatric medical conditions that may require a pediatric surgeon?

Some common pediatric medical conditions that may require the expertise of a pediatric surgeon include congenital heart defects, cleft lip and palate, hernias, appendicitis, orthopedic conditions, and various types of tumors. Pediatric surgeons are trained to address a wide range of surgical needs specific to children.
